Output 96bc63df90ef169a2e2a1a367b8dbc951da6665bc3b866e0e4d505690ebbea3b:1

value
1753414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880961193f42a446d6fe52caa664ca7480afe6c3 OP_EQUAL
address
3E6K4KMcSJjXBfZYrqe2U32Axd4QpWyQYo
transaction
96bc63df90ef169a2e2a1a367b8dbc951da6665bc3b866e0e4d505690ebbea3b
spent
true